Dynamic Growth for Devicie in Microsoft Intune Management
Devicie, a prominent name in automated Microsoft Intune device management, has recently made headlines with an exciting announcement. The company has secured a substantial growth investment from Insight Partners, a renowned global software investor. This strategic move is set to amplify Devicie’s capabilities and commitment to delivering Microsoft-first solutions to organizations worldwide.

The Power of Microsoft Intune
Microsoft leads the world in productivity applications, boasting a significant user base among Fortune 500 companies. With over 70% of these corporations utilizing Microsoft 365—including Intune for device management—Devicie’s role as a facilitator is crucial. Their multi-tenant solution helps IT teams and Managed Service Providers (MSPs) transition to a cloud-native approach with ease. Features like zero-touch configuration, automatic updates, application patching, and built-in remediation capabilities significantly enhance endpoint security and management.
This comprehensive system allows for improved operational efficiency and provides organizations with better visibility and reporting, optimizing the overall productivity landscape.

Founded in Sydney, Australia, Devicie has made strategic moves, including relocating its headquarters to Tampa Bay, Florida. This transition aims to enhance service delivery and strengthen collaboration with Microsoft, as Devicie becomes more actively involved in initiatives like the Microsoft for Startups Pegasus Program and the Microsoft Intelligent Security Association (MISA).
